Question
A current of 1 A deposits 0.635 g of Cu from CuSO₄ in 1930 s. What is the time required to deposit 0.54 g of Al from Al₂(SO₄)₃ with the same current? (Atomic masses: Cu = 63.5 g/mol, Al = 27 g/mol, F = 96500 C/mol)
Explanation
Cu: Cu²⁺ + 2e⁻ → Cu , Moles = (0.635/63.5) = 0.01 mol , Charge = 0.01 × 2 × 96500 = 1930 C , matches 1 × 1930 . Al: Al³⁺ + 3e⁻ → Al , Moles = (0.54/27) = 0.02 mol , Charge = 0.02 × 3 × 96500 = 5790 C . t = (5790/1) = 5790 s .
